Score 93/100 · Drink 2021-2028, Monica Larner, Wine Advocate, Nov 2021

The Donnafugata 2017 Sicilia Mille e Una Notte is a modern and contemporary wine that piggybacks on the scorching heat and drought of the vintage to offer even more concentration and richness. Black fruit aromas of blackberry preserves and blackcurrant segue to spice, tar and tobacco over a generous, full-bodied texture. Nero d'Avola is blended with smaller parts Petit Verdot, Syrah and other complementary grapes. The wine registers a 13.5% alcohol content, but it feels like more. I suggest a ten-year drinking window for this vintage (with 70,000 bottles made).

Score 94/100 · James Suckling, Aug 2021

The enticing nose of blackcurrant, blackberry, cardamon and anise with hints of old balsamic vinegar and smoke, pulls you into this very Mediterranean red. In spite of the serious tannin structure and rather dry palate, it's beautifully proportioned. Complex dried-lemon and caper character at the long, precise finish. Drinkable now, but best from 2023.
